The microscopic war on your threshold

A shower door seal falls off because of a combination of surface contamination, mechanical friction, and the gradual degradation of the polymer due to hard water deposits. If the glass surface is not chemically neutral, the adhesive bond fails within weeks of installation under high humidity. This is not just about the glue. It is about the molecular state of the tempered glass. When you install a new seal, the surface looks clean to the naked eye. To a professional, that surface is covered in a microscopic layer of silicate dust, calcium carbonate, and fatty acids from soap. If you do not strip that glass down to its raw state, you are just sticking plastic to a layer of grime. I tell my customers that if they do not use a denatured alcohol or a high-purity solvent before applying a new seal, they are wasting their time and my inventory. The seal needs a high-energy surface to grab onto, and the humidity in your bathroom is actively trying to push the adhesive off the glass.

Why a millimeter of movement destroys polymers

Physical movement is the silent killer of every shower seal. When the glass door swings, it creates a minute amount of torque. If the hinges have even a fraction of a millimeter of play, the seal at the bottom or the side is dragged across the tile or the metal threshold. This creates mechanical friction that exceeds the shear strength of the adhesive. Over time, this friction stretches the polymer. The seal loses its memory. It starts to sag. Once the sag begins, the seal starts catching on the tile every time you open the door. It is a feedback loop of failure. In my decades of experience, I have found that most people ignore the alignment of the door. They think the seal is there to compensate for a crooked door. It is not. The seal is there to provide a water-tight barrier for a perfectly aligned system. If your door is hanging heavy on one side, no amount of high-grade silicone is going to keep that seal attached for more than a few months. It will buckle under the pressure of the constant dragging.

The structural lie of the shower curb

The shower curb is often the most neglected part of the entire installation. Many contractors build them with wood 2x4s and then wonder why the tile starts to heave. If the curb is not perfectly level, the door seal cannot sit flush. Water then pools against the seal. This constant immersion leads to hydraulic pressure that works its way behind the plastic. Most homeowners do not realize that water is a powerful solvent over time. It finds the smallest gap in the adhesive and begins to widen it. If your curb has a slight dip, the seal has to flex more in that specific spot. That flex creates a localized stress point. Eventually, the bond snaps. Chemical warfare in the cleaning cabinet

The very chemicals you use to make your bathroom sparkle are likely the reason your seal is on the floor. Harsh alkaline cleaners or acidic sprays eat away at the plasticizers in the door seal. This process is called leaching. When the plasticizers leave the seal, it becomes brittle. A brittle seal does not flex; it cracks. Once it cracks, the structural integrity is gone. I always warn people about the generic sprays they buy at big-box retailers. They are too aggressive. They break down the bond between the grout and the tile, and they definitely break down the adhesive on your door. If you want longevity, you need to understand the chemistry of what you are spraying. Use pH-neutral cleaners that do not leave a film. If you leave a film on the glass, the next seal you try to install will never stick. The 1/8 inch that ruins everything

Precision is not a suggestion. In the flooring world, we live and die by the level. The same applies to the vertical lines of a shower door. If the wall is out of plumb by 1/8 of an inch, the gap between the door and the wall is uneven. Most installers try to fill this gap with a thicker seal. This is a mistake. A thicker seal has more surface area, which means more weight and more leverage for the water to push against. It also means the seal is under constant compression on one end and zero compression on the other. This uneven loading causes the seal to peel from the top down. I have seen it a thousand times. You cannot fix a structural plumbing issue with a piece of plastic. You have to shim the hinges or adjust the glass. Grout failures and the moisture trap

If the grout around your shower door is cracking or missing, it allows moisture to travel behind the metal tracks or the glass channels. This moisture creates a humid micro-climate that never dries out. It is the perfect breeding ground for mold and mildew which will eventually eat through the seal’s adhesive. Protocols for permanent seal adhesion

To stop the cycle of falling seals, you must follow a rigid installation protocol. It is not about the speed of the job. It is about the preparation of the materials. If you rush the cure time, you fail. If you ignore the temperature of the room, you fail. Here is the checklist I use when I have to fix a customer’s botched DIY job.

  • Strip the glass using a razor blade to remove physical debris and old silicone.
  • Clean the surface with a lint-free cloth and 99 percent isopropyl alcohol.
  • Check the alignment of the door with a laser level to ensure no dragging.
  • Apply a high-modulus silicone adhesive specifically rated for wet environments.
  • Allow the seal to cure for a full 24 hours before exposing it to any moisture.
  • Check the baseboards outside the shower for signs of water damage that indicate a persistent leak.

If you follow these steps, you are not just sticking a piece of plastic to glass. You are engineering a moisture barrier. You are ensuring that the tile stays dry and the floor remains stable.
